Worth the money
For the price, this thing is worth it. I'm only 5'6" / 155lbs and do not do many violent / cross fit movements so i'm not swinging everywhere. But i do add extra weights when i do pull ups and dips (about 45-135 on a weight belt) which does swing a little. Yes the structure does flex a little and squeak, but at no point do i feel like its going to topple over. I also have this on very soft workout mats that doesnt help keep this thing sturdy. Still not worried when doing workouts and i'm generally pretty cautious. I do also like that the structure is light where i can move it all over the place by myself. However it is not good as an anchor for workout bands and it will pull the rack. It never specified that this was the purpose so never expected it to fulfill that need. Would suggest if you are on a budget or dont want to go crazy on a full home gym.
